WebOn March 30, 1981, fewer than 100 days into President Ronald Reagan’s first year in office, John Hinckley Jr. attempted to assassinate the president outside the Washington Hilton Hotel. Reagan was injured by a single bullet, and through the Miller Center's Ronald Reagan Oral History Project, members of his administration recall their thoughts ...
